In a Brutal Summer, Miracles Still Bloom

A New York Times opinion article by Margaret Renkl.  Margaret speaks on where she has come to rely on this deeply interdependent cycle of: vine, leaf, flower, bee, butterfly, caterpillar, fruit, hungry wildlife in her garden, in spite of the record heat and lack of rain.
